Resolve "Create Backup for Server" Button Issue in Jira Cloud

Platform Notice: Cloud Only - This article only applies to Atlassian products on the cloud platform.

Summary

When trying to create a server backup, the button might be greyed out, although no team-managed projects are listed.

Diagnosis

  • Navigate to Administration (⚙) >System > Backup Manager

  • Scroll down to the Backup for server

  • The button Create backup for server is greyed out

Cause

When team-managed projects are not permanently deleted, they will still be considered as existing projects.

Solution

  1. Check that no team-managed projects are listed under Projects > View all projects.

  2. Go to Jira settings ⚙ > Projects.

  3. Click on Trash and check for any team-managed projects in here.

  4. Permanently delete any team-managed projects in the trash by clicking ... > Delete permanently.

  5. Now, the backup for server option should be available.
